The record

"The Book Of Doors" is based on the concepts of the universal language of the symbols of Egypt, and on the archetypal nature of Egyptian deities. Two occult keys comprise the magical system behind this deck: the alchemical text known as the Emerald Tablet of Hermes Trismegistus (which describes the transmutation of primal elements to pure gold), and the numerical system of Pythagorus (specifically the magic square that provides the basis of the numbering for the Neteru). Within this magical square the eight families of the Neteru are arranged according to element (which defines their function) and by the evolution of the Mysteries in the major religious centers of Heliopolis, Memphis and Thebes. This is a system meant to be used with great care - with emphasis on the sacred when working with divination, meditation, and magical invocation and evocation. It is meant to act as a doorway to the voices of ancient Egypt, much as Tarot acts as a doorway to the archetypes that it represents. The Neteru as presented here represent their evolution over the ages - some merging with others, some fading away, some coming to the forefront of their time.
